    大鼠生長分化因子15(GDF15)酶聯(lián)免疫試劑盒(CSB-E16317r)為競爭法ELISA試劑盒,定量檢測血清、血漿、組織勻漿樣本中的GDF15含量。GDF15是一種生長分化因子。其它在多種組織中表達(dá),與細(xì)胞生長、分化等密切相關(guān)。研究機制上,它能通過與特定受體結(jié)合參與機體能量代謝、炎癥反應(yīng)等調(diào)節(jié),在腫瘤、代謝疾病等研究中受關(guān)注。試劑盒檢測范圍為1.56 pg/mL-100 pg/mL,適用于能量代謝調(diào)控機制研究、心血管疾病動物模型評估、腫瘤相關(guān)病理分析等科研場景本品僅用于科研,不用于臨床診斷,產(chǎn)品具體參數(shù)及操作步驟詳見產(chǎn)品說明書。

  • 功能:
    Regulates food intake, energy expenditure and body weight in response to metabolic and toxin-induced stresses. Binds to its receptor, GFRAL, and activates GFRAL-expressing neurons localized in the area postrema and nucleus tractus solitarius of the brainstem. It then triggers the activation of neurons localized within the parabrachial nucleus and central amygdala, which constitutes part of the 'emergency circuit' that shapes feeding responses to stressful conditions (Probable). On hepatocytes, inhibits growth hormone signaling.
  • 基因功能參考文獻(xiàn):
    1. These findings demonstrate the importance of the AP in the mediation of cancer-dependent anorexia and body weight loss and support a pathological role of MIC-1 as a tumour-derived factor mediating CACS, possibly via an AP-dependent action. PMID: 28025863
    2. Plasma GDF-15 was increased 3, 12 and 26, while plasma TGF-beta was increased 12 weeks after irradiation. PMID: 27566082
    3. the time course of the expression of growth differentiation factor15 (GDF15) in rat ischemic myocardium with increasing durations of reperfusion, and to elucidate its physiopathological role in the noreflow phenomenon, is reported. PMID: 26647773
    4. findings indicate that the attenuation of REV-ERBalpha leads to an upregulation of Gdf10 and Gdf15 in decidual cells PMID: 26811051
    5. GDF15 protects the renal interstitium and tubular compartment in experimental type 1 and 2 diabetes without affecting glomerular damage PMID: 23986522
    6. Up-regulation of EGR-1 and NAG-1, along with higher reactive oxygen species load may positively regulate the intrinsic pathway of apoptosis for the NSAID mediated chemoprevention of colorectal cancer. PMID: 23435960
    7. Gdf15 expression exhibits increases >10-fold at night in the rat pineal gland, reaching levels that are >15-fold higher than the median in other tissues. PMID: 19103603
